

James was born in Ashford, Alabama to James Roy Lewis Sr. and Mildred Dorothy Lewis on July 6, 1944. He went to school in Fairfax County. He graduated from Falls Church High School.
He worked as a truck driver for his own company called JRL Trucking, Inc. He was a veteran of the Vietnam Era and served in the Army.
He was involved in leather making crafts, wine making, member of National Muzzle Loading Rifle Association, and collector of black powder rifles.
James is preceded in death by James Roy Lewis Sr. and Mildred Dorothy Lewis.
James is survived by son James Lewis III, daughter Jessica Keener and spouse Kenneth Keener; daughter Vicky McHuen and spouse Jason McHuen; brother Fred Lewis and spouse Linda Lewis; Grandchildren: Zachary Keener, Briana Fidler and spouse Kennth Fidler, Zoe Keener, Alyssa McHuen, Brandon Keener, and Kaitlyn Lewis.
